…In Latin, it is Graecia, and in modern European languages, many are derived from Latin, but words derived from Greek are also used. For example, in English, it is Greece or Hellas, in German, Griechenland or Hellas, in French, Grèce or Hellade, and in Italian, Grecia (words of Greek origin are ellenico for 'Greek' and ellenismo for Hellenism). The Chinese character '希臘' is a transliteration of Hellas. … *Some of the terminology explanations that mention "Grecia" are listed below.
